摘要:
MySQL单表多大进行分库分表? 目前主流的有两种说法: MySQL 单表数据量大于 2000 万行,性能会明显下降,考虑进行分库分表。 阿里巴巴《Java 开发手册》提出单表行数超过 500 万行或者单表容量超过 2GB,才推荐进行分库分表。 事实上,这个数值和实际记录的条数无关,而与 MySQL 阅读全文
摘要:
记几个函数: -- 计算年龄 select floor( MONTHS_BETWEEN(sysdate,birthday)/12) from dual;--从数据库中取值 -- 返回指定位数数字UUID 点击查看代码 CREATE OR REPLACE FUNCTION F_GET_UUID (n 阅读全文
摘要:
git reset --hard HEAD^ 可以本地删掉最后一个commit。 git push --force-with-lease 推送到远程删掉最后一个commit。 git cherry-pick HASH 最后本地恢复最后一个commit。 git reset --hard commit 阅读全文
摘要:
show table status 获取表的信息 show table status like 'tableName' \G 1.Name 表名称 2.Engine: 表的存储引擎 3.Version: 版本 4.Row_format 行格式。对于MyISAM引擎,这可能是Dynamic,Fixed 阅读全文
摘要:
什么是Nginx? Nginx是一个 轻量级/高性能的反向代理Web服务器,用于 HTTP、HTTPS、SMTP、POP3 和 IMAP 协议。他实现非常高效的反向代理、负载平衡,他可以处理2-3万并发连接数,官方监测能支持5万并发,现在中国使用nginx网站用户有很多,例如:新浪、网易、 腾讯等。 阅读全文
摘要:
很多人问如何从高级到专家,如何看待 35 岁职业危机,今天分享一个反例,先来看看一个不好的程序员是什么样的,希望有所帮助。 软件行业的工作经验和从事这个行业的工作年限直接相关。这句话在某种程度上是对的,但是从事这项工作的年限,并不一定代表获得了相同年限的工作经验。 正如一句话所说:“我们以为我们是工 阅读全文
摘要:
使用情况: 当您的库中删除了大量的数据后,您可能会发现数据文件尺寸并没有减小。这是因为删除操作后在数据文件中留下碎片所致。 OPTIMIZE TABLE只对MyISAM, BDB和InnoDB表起作用。 对于BDB表,OPTIMIZE TABLE目前被映射到ANALYZE TABLE上。 对于Inn 阅读全文
摘要:
原文,https://blog.csdn.net/weixin_39569543/article/details/111090287 结论: 阿里java开发手册禁止三张表join 大数据量下使用join导致数据冗余更大,MySQL处理不了过大的数据量,Oracle可以正常处理 阅读全文
摘要:
SELECT a.co1 ,CASE WHEN LEFT(hangye,2)in(13,14,15,16) THEN '食品' WHEN LEFT(hangye,2)in(17,18,19,28) THEN '纺织' ELSE '其他' END AS Leixing ,a.zhandi ,shuis 阅读全文